Transaction 412214911900e51bcb3d824f03de6a1cbaf28149773e039508e50188aba5f69e

1 Input
2 Outputs
  • 412214911900e51bcb3d824f03de6a1cbaf28149773e039508e50188aba5f69e:0
  • value  324390
    address  3AfHauU6nYuHfcRLUHrU6MducDtu41pqgA
  • 412214911900e51bcb3d824f03de6a1cbaf28149773e039508e50188aba5f69e:1
  • value  1243946
    address  bc1qsz3vth3k3sgrzyxv34mzvdgp0v9pcd4uvyx5r3